1. a) In the case of a Blended Production where fifty-one percent (51%) ormore of the longest initial version of the program consists of live-actioncontent, the Writer(s) shall be contracted under the general provisions ofthe Independent Production Agreement.b) In the case of a Blended Production where fifty-one percent (51%) ormore of the longest initial version of the program consists of animationcontent, the Writer(s) shall be contracted under the Animation Section.2. Where a program does not clearly fall into 1a) or b) above, the Guild, theProducer and the relevant Association shall discuss the appropriatecontracting for the program. Where the parties above are unable to agree, thematter shall be referred to a Joint Standing Committee, or, at the request ofany of the parties, to Arbitration.152
